Why Upgrading Your Insulation Matters in Saskatchewan Winters
Saskatchewan residents know that winters can be long, cold, and tough on homes. Poor insulation means heat loss, drafty rooms, and rising utility costs. According to local energy experts, homes in Moose Jaw and surrounding areas can lose up to 25% of their heat through poorly insulated walls, roofs, and basements.
But insulation is more than just battling the cold. With the right products and installation, you can:
- Maintain a steady, comfortable indoor temperature
- Reduce strain on your furnace and HVAC systems
- Cut heating and cooling costs substantially
- Improve indoor air quality and create a quieter home
What Are the Signs Your Home Needs Better Insulation?
Not sure if it’s time for an upgrade? Here’s what to watch for in your Saskatchewan home:
- Ice dams or icicles forming on roof edges
- Noticeable cold spots or drafts near windows and doors
- Rising heating bills despite no changes in usage
- Uneven temperatures between rooms or floors
- Aging or visibly damaged insulation in your attic or crawlspaces

How Often Should You Replace Home Insulation?
A trending question among Canadian homeowners is, “How often should I replace my insulation?” The answer depends on your current insulation type and the age of your home. In Saskatchewan, where temperature extremes are common, most experts recommend assessing insulation every 15-20 years. However, damage from pests, moisture, or renovations can shorten this timeline.
